Lamborghini speeding into Leng Kee stretch
Italian supercar marque will share premises with Alfa Romeo as well as parallel importer VinCar
Published Tue, May 30, 2017 · 09:50 PM
Singapore
LAMBORGHINI will finally set up shop in the prime motor belt when it speeds into 24 Leng Kee Road by September.
It is understood that the Italian supercar marque fronted by Melvin Goh and his Catalist company EuroSports Global will park itself in a ground floor showroom of a new eight-storey building owned and developed by Wealth Assets.
